Llanelli Station is well-equipped to make your travel as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:10 to 12:40 and on Saturdays from 07:00 to 13:30. For added convenience, ticket machines are available for quick purchases and online ticket collections. Additionally, the station features accessible machines with video assist options, ensuring everyone can travel with ease. Moreover, the station is built with partial step-free access, allowing seamless movement between platforms, even though assistance may be required due to its B1 category status.
Stay informed with customer help points and constantly updated screens displaying departures and arrivals. Though the station doesn’t offer luggage storage, you'll find CCTV-operated bicycle stands with 16 spaces for those cycling to the station. Waiting rooms are open during the ticket office hours, offering a comfortable place to sit before your journey.
While at Llanelli Station, you can grab a quick bite at the food outlet on Platform 1. Unfortunately, facilities like ATMs, shops, and currency exchanges are not available at the station, but you can make use of accessible toilets and customer support during staffed hours.

Penshurst Station is straightforward in its offerings, providing essential services for those embarking on a journey. While there isn't a ticket office, travelers can still collect tickets purchased online via accessible ticket machines. The station features an induction loop for the hearing impaired and support for travelers with disabilities is available through help points.
Accessibility is a mixed bag at Penshurst. While some facilities are step-free, certain areas of the station aren't. Specifically, there is step-free access to both platforms via separate entrances, but there is no step-free transition between platforms. Assistance can be pre-arranged, or accessed by using on-board train staff when available. The station lacks wa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ities, which travelers should keep in mind when planning their visit.
